As a reasonably sized middle school in ST LOUIS, Missouri, MARGARET BUERKLE MIDDLE serves 549 students from grades 6 through 8, part of MEHLVILLE R-IX.
Within MEHLVILLE R-IX, which oversees 19 schools and 10,095 students, MARGARET BUERKLE MIDDLE is one campus in the system.
Looking at the student body, MARGARET BUERKLE MIDDLE reports that White students make up the majority at 69%. Other groups include 11% Black, 9% Asian, 6% multiracial, 4% Hispanic.
On the resource side, Staff filings list 46 full-time-equivalent teachers, which works out to roughly 12.0:1 students per teacher. That figure is tighter than the state norm's 13.0:1 average. An estimated 52% of students are eligible for free or reduced-price lunch, which schools and policymakers use as a rough income-mix signal. Set against St. Louis County (around 43%), the school's rate is noticeably above typical.

In the broader community, the surrounding county (St. Louis County) logs that median household income runs about $82,936, 47%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, and the poverty rate sits near 7%. MARGARET BUERKLE MIDDLE is one of 275 public schools in St. Louis County (combined enrollment of about 134,601 students).
Nearest neighbor: MEHLVILLE HIGH SCHOOL, around 0.7 miles off. Counting just inside five miles, 8 other public schools cluster around MARGARET BUERKLE MIDDLE. On composite proficiency, MARGARET BUERKLE MIDDLE comes 3rd of 8 in the immediate cluster, ahead of the nearby-schools average of 56.0%.
Geographically, the school is in a suburban area.
Five-year trend. MARGARET BUERKLE MIDDLE's enrollment has decreased 9% since 2018, when it stood at 604 (now 549). The White share of enrollment shrank from 75% to 69% over that span. Class-load math has tightened: from 14.9:1 in 2018 to 12.0:1 in 2025.
